New York mayor on Germany trip: Trump doesn't represent Americans

Facing widespread criticism over his decision to fly to Hamburg just after the shooting death of a Bronx police officer, New York City Mayor Bill de Blasio said Americans’ views don’t align with President Trump’s and need to be represented abroad.

“While the national governments will probably only make limited progress, the rest of us don’t have that choice. If we make only limited progress we’ll only be going backwards,” de Blasio told Bloomberg before speaking at a Saturday protest that coincides with the Group of 20 summit attended by Trump and other world leaders in Germany. “We almost have Washington as an island at this point, unrepresentative of the views of the American people on many levels, and that’s going to take a different kind of politics to address.”

De Blasio’s speech at the protest, called “Hamburg Shows Attitude,” reflected a similar theme of citizens and localities defying the policies of the national government, specifically on issues such as climate change and marriage equality.




“American cities are signed on to the Paris Accords. We will do it ourselves,” de Blasio said at the rally, according to tweets from his spokesman, Eric Phillips. He and other mayors from across the United States have vowed to uphold the Paris agreement, sidestepping Trump after he withdrew the country from the climate deal.
